Output 3126d2eda8e5e62c3bb5696fb55babd6a0979041e2aa23febe557c25d5dfb049:5

value
3477060
script pubkey
OP_0 OP_PUSHBYTES_20 c2cab2f15ee5fd8fb25311dea416b8764c1d051e
address
bc1qct9t9u27uh7clvjnz802g94cwexp6pg7hcfsvw
transaction
3126d2eda8e5e62c3bb5696fb55babd6a0979041e2aa23febe557c25d5dfb049
spent
true